DNS 이중화는 여러 DNS 서버를 활용하여 도메인 이름 해석의 신뢰성과 장애 복원력을 보장하는 중요한 실천 방법입니다. 이 설정은 DNS 인프라의 단일 장애 지점으로 인한 서비스 중단 위험을 완화합니다. 여러 서버에 작업 부하를 분산함으로써 DNS 이중화는 전체 성능을 개선하고 원활하고 지속적인 도메인 해석을 보장합니다.
사용자가 웹사이트에 접속하려고 할 때, 그들의 장치는 도메인 이름을 IP 주소로 변환하기 위해 DNS 서버에 쿼리를 전송합니다. DNS 이중화는 이러한 쿼리를 처리하고 올바른 IP 주소로 응답할 수 있는 여러 DNS 서버의 존재에 의존합니다. 하나의 서버가 응답하지 않거나 접근 불가능해지면, 시스템은 자동으로 쿼리를 다른 작동 가능한 서버로 라우팅하여 잠재적인 다운타임이나 서비스 중단을 효과적으로 제거합니다.
DNS 이중화가 작동하는 방식을 설명하기 위해 다음 시나리오를 고려해 보십시오:
여러 DNS 서버가 쿼리를 처리하고 올바른 IP 주소로 응답할 수 있도록 함으로써 DNS 이중화는 도메인 이름 해석 과정에서 높은 가용성과 장애 복원력을 보장합니다.
DNS 이중화는 도메인 이름 해석 시스템의 전반적인 신뢰성과 효율성을 높이는 여러 이점을 제공합니다:
여러 DNS 서버에 작업 부하를 분산함으로써 DNS 이중화는 단일 장애 지점의 위험을 최소화합니다. 서버 장애나 정전 시, 시스템은 쿼리를 작동 중인 서버로 자동으로 리디렉션하여 서비스 가용성을 보장합니다.
DNS 이중화는 부하 분산 메커니즘을 활성화하여 성능을 향상시킵니다. 이러한 메커니즘은 중복 서버 간에 DNS 쿼리를 분산하여 자원 활용을 최적화하고 특정 서버의 과부하를 방지합니다. 결과적으로, DNS 이중화는 응답 시간을 크게 줄이고 전반적인 사용자 경험을 향상시킬 수 있습니다.
다양한 지리적 위치나 네트워크에 중복 DNS 서버를 구현하면 추가적인 이중화 계층이 추가됩니다. 이러한 지리적 분포는 지역 장애가 발생하더라도 다른 위치에서 도메인 이름 해석 서비스를 계속 사용할 수 있도록 하여 국부적인 중단의 영향을 줄여줍니다.
DNS 이중화를 효과적으로 구현하려면 다음의 주요 고려 사항을 참고하십시오:
DNS 인프라의 아키텍처와 설계는 효과적인 이중화를 보장하는 데 중요합니다. 여기에는 DNS 서버의 수와 위치를 결정하고, 성능과 장애 복원력을 최적화하기 위한 부하 분산 메커니즘을 구성하는 것이 포함됩니다.
네트워크와 사용자 기반이 성장함에 따라 DNS 이중화 솔루션의 확장성을 고려하는 것이 중요합니다. 성능이나 신뢰성을 저해하지 않고 증가하는 쿼리 양을 처리하고 변화하는 요구 사항에 적응할 수 있는 인프라를 보장하십시오.
잠재적인 문제가 중단을 초래하기 전에 파악하고 해결하기 위해 DNS 서버의 건강과 성능을 정기적으로 모니터링하는 것이 중요합니다. 장애 전환 테스트와 같은 주기적인 테스트를 수행하면 장애 전환 메커니즘이 올바르게 작동하며, DNS 이중화가 의도한 대로 기능하고 있는지 확인할 수 있습니다.
DNS 이중화는 도메인 이름 해석 시스템의 신뢰성과 장애 복원력을 보장하는 데 중요한 역할을 합니다. 중복 DNS 서버를 구현하고, 쿼리 부하를 분산하며, 정기적으로 건강을 모니터링함으로써 조직은 DNS 인프라의 가용성과 성능을 크게 향상시킬 수 있습니다. DNS 이중화를 통해 기업은 단일 장애 지점과 관련된 위험을 최소화하고 사용자의 원활하고 지속적인 도메인 해석 서비스를 제공할 수 있습니다.